    Job Description

    Nyota Njema Real Estate is seeking a Digital Marketing Executive to plan, create, and schedule marketing materials, manage daily social media posts, and drive online leads. The role involves content creation, analytics, ads management, and supporting sales activities. The successful candidate will also oversee branding for NNRE Ltd and Kikwetu Sacco.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Plan, create, and schedule marketing materials photography, videography, graphics using a structured content calendar.
    • Daily posts and engagement across Facebook, Instagram, YouTube, TikTok, and LinkedIn.
    • Daily reporting and evaluation of social media performance using Meta and Google analytics.
    • Meta ads management, company website profile management, Google ads, and analytics.
    • Oversight of NNRE Ltd and Kikwetu Sacco branding and related materials.
    • Responding to and tracking customer inquiries from ads campaigns.
    • Drive online leads and assist with sales activities.
    • Any additional responsibilities as may be assigned by the C.O.O.

    Required Qualifications

    •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field.
    • Minimum 3 years' experience as a Digital Marketing Specialist or in a similar role.
    • Understanding of social media platforms, tools, analytics, and current trends.
    •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to craft compelling content.
    • Experience in social media advertising and campaign management, including analyzing performance metrics and adapting strategies.
    • Proficiency in graphic design tools is an added advantage.
    • Ability to multitask, meets deadlines, and thrives in a fast-paced environment.

    Show Content That Converts, Not Just Content That Looks Good

    Real estate marketing is about generating leads and closing sales, not just getting likes. The hiring team at Nyota Njema will be looking for proof that you can turn social media engagement into actual inquiries and sales opportunities.

    1. Build a portfolio around lead generation: Don't just show pretty posts. For each campaign in your portfolio, state the goal (e.g., increase inquiries), the actions you took, and the measurable results (e.g., cost per lead, conversion rate). If you have examples from real estate or similar high-ticket industries, highlight them.

    2. Prove you can handle the full funnel: This role spans content creation, ads management, and sales support. Show that you understand how a social media post becomes a qualified lead and eventually a sale. Be ready to explain how you would track a lead from an ad click to a property viewing.

    3. Get specific about your analytics skills: The job requires daily reporting using Meta and Google analytics. Be prepared to discuss metrics like reach, engagement, click-through rate, and cost per lead. Bring examples of reports you've created and how you used the data to adjust your strategy.

    4. Show your content creation range: You'll be doing photography, videography, and graphics. If you have a portfolio of visual content, bring it. Even if you're not a professional designer, show that you can create clean, on-brand visuals using tools like Canva or Adobe Spark.

    5. Understand the real estate audience: Real estate buyers are often making a big financial decision. Your content should build trust and showcase properties effectively. Think about how you would highlight the unique selling points of a property and address common buyer concerns.

    6. Prepare for a multi-brand role: You'll oversee branding for both NNRE Ltd and Kikwetu Sacco. Show that you can maintain consistent brand messaging across different entities. Be ready to discuss how you would adapt your content strategy for each brand's target audience.

    7. Be ready to talk about ad budgets: Meta ads management is a key part of the job. Be prepared to discuss how you would allocate a budget across different campaigns, how you would test ad creatives, and how you would optimize for the best return on ad spend.

    8. Show you're a fast learner: The real estate market and social media trends are always changing. Demonstrate your willingness to learn new tools and strategies. Mention any courses, certifications, or self-learning you've done to stay current.
